Preparing the Pitch – Central Bank of Ireland Publishes Consultation and Q&A Updates for ILPs and Closed-Ended QIAIFs

Dechert LLP | | Return|
The Central Bank of Ireland (the “Central Bank”) has published two documents which are significant steps towards enhancing the private equity and private credit product offerings currently available in Ireland. These documents have been published in anticipation of the update to the Investment Limited Partnerships Act, which is currently making its way through the Irish parliamentary process....
